The Distinction Between Big Data and Cloud Computing153


As the digital revolution continues to transform various sectors, big data and cloud computing have emerged as two pivotal technologies driving innovation. While these terms are often used interchangeably, it is essential to recognize their distinct characteristics and the synergies they create.

Understanding Big Data

Big data refers to vast and complex datasets that traditional data processing tools cannot easily analyze. Its primary attributes include volume, velocity, variety, veracity, and value.
Volume: Big data sets are typically measured in terabytes, petabytes, or even exabytes.
Velocity: These datasets are generated and updated at an unprecedented pace, requiring real-time or near-real-time processing.
Variety: Big data encompasses various data types, such as structured, semi-structured, and unstructured data.
Veracity: The accuracy and completeness of big data can vary, making it crucial to employ appropriate data quality measures.
Value: The ultimate goal of big data analysis is to extract valuable insights and intelligence that can drive decision-making and improve business outcomes.

Unraveling Cloud Computing

Cloud computing refers to a distributed computing model that provides access to computing resources, such as servers, storage, databases, and software, over the internet. This delivery model allows organizations to consume these resources on demand, eliminating the need for on-premises infrastructure.

Key characteristics of cloud computing include:
On-demand provisioning: Cloud services are available on a self-service basis, enabling users to provision and release resources as needed.
Elasticity: Cloud infrastructure can scale up or down dynamically, adapting to changing demand patterns.
Pay-as-you-go pricing: Cloud providers charge users only for the resources they consume, eliminating capital expenditure and ongoing maintenance costs.
Geographic distribution: Cloud data centers are distributed across multiple regions, enhancing data availability and minimizing latency.

Synergies Between Big Data and Cloud Computing

While big data and cloud computing are distinct technologies, they complement each other synergistically. Cloud computing provides the scalable infrastructure and on-demand resources necessary to store, process, and analyze massive datasets. Big data analytics, in turn, enables organizations to gain insights from these vast data repositories, which can be used to optimize cloud resource utilization and improve overall efficiency.
Cost optimization: Big data analytics can help identify underutilized cloud resources and optimize consumption patterns, reducing overall costs.
Performance enhancement: Analytics can identify bottlenecks and inefficiencies in cloud deployments, enabling organizations to fine-tune their configurations for optimal performance.
Security and compliance: Analytics can monitor cloud usage patterns for security anomalies and compliance breaches, ensuring data protection and regulatory adherence.
Innovation acceleration: Big data analytics can generate valuable insights that can drive innovation in cloud solutions, enhancing their capabilities and value.

Conclusion

Big data and cloud computing are two transformative technologies that are shaping the digital landscape. While they have distinct characteristics, they work synergistically to unlock powerful capabilities for organizations. By leveraging the scalable infrastructure of cloud computing and the analytical power of big data, businesses can gain valuable insights, optimize their operations, and drive innovation.

As both technologies continue to evolve, we can expect even greater synergies and advancements that will further empower businesses to thrive in the data-driven era.

2024-11-21


Previous:Comprehensive Guide to Video Development for Android

Next:How to Use MetaTrader 4 on Mobile: A Comprehensive Guide for Beginners